Hiring a verification engineer in India, Chennai, can be a strategic move for companies looking to leverage top talent in the semiconductor and electronics industry. Verification engineers play a crucial role in ensuring the quality and reliability of complex chip designs and electronic systems.
With the cost of living in Chennai being relatively lower compared to other major tech hubs, companies can find skilled professionals at competitive rates. Chennai's strong educational infrastructure and presence of major semiconductor companies make it an ideal location for finding verification engineers with the right expertise.
Why Choose Chennai for Verification Engineers
Chennai has emerged as a significant hub for the electronics and semiconductor industry in India. The city is home to numerous top tech companies, startups, and research institutions, creating a vibrant ecosystem for verification engineers.
Examples include local universities, bootcamps, and professional meetups that provide opportunities for networking and skill development. The city's infrastructure and connectivity also make it an attractive location for companies looking to set up or expand their operations.
- Strong presence of semiconductor and electronics companies
- Good educational institutions offering relevant courses
- Professional meetups and conferences
- Competitive cost of living
- Good connectivity and infrastructure
Key Skills to Look For
Proficiency in HDLs
A verification engineer should be proficient in Hardware Description Languages (HDLs) such as Verilog and VHDL. They should be able to write testbenches and testcases to verify the design.
Understanding of Verification Methodologies
Knowledge of verification methodologies like UVM (Universal Verification Methodology) is crucial. The engineer should be able to apply these methodologies to develop robust verification environments.
Familiarity with Simulation Tools
Familiarity with simulation tools like VCS, QuestaSim, or Incisive is necessary for running simulations and debugging issues.
Programming Skills
Proficiency in programming languages like Python or C++ is beneficial for developing automation scripts and integrating with other tools.
Soft Skills
Good communication and teamwork skills are essential for collaborating with design teams and other stakeholders.
Industry Exposure
Experience in the semiconductor or electronics industry is a plus, as it indicates familiarity with industry standards and practices.
Debugging Skills
The ability to debug complex issues using waveform analysis and log files is critical.
Knowledge of Design Flows
Understanding of the design flow, from RTL to synthesis and implementation, is beneficial.
Screening & Interviewing Process
Initial Screening
The initial screening involves reviewing resumes to shortlist candidates with the required skills and experience.
Technical Interviews
Technical interviews are conducted to assess the candidate's technical skills and problem-solving abilities.
Practical Tests
Practical tests or coding challenges are given to evaluate the candidate's hands-on skills.
Sample Interview Questions for Verification Engineer
- Can you explain the difference between a testbench and a testcase?
- How do you debug a failing test?
- What is your experience with UVM?
- Can you write a simple testbench in Verilog?
- How do you ensure the quality of your testbenches?
Behavioral Interviews
Behavioral interviews are conducted to assess the candidate's soft skills and cultural fit.
Factors for Successful Collaboration
Clear Briefs
Providing clear briefs and specifications is essential for ensuring that the verification engineer understands the requirements.
Regular Check-ins
Regular check-ins and progress updates help in tracking the project's status and addressing any issues promptly.
Use of Collaboration Tools
Using collaboration tools like Trello, Asana, Slack, or WhatsApp facilitates communication and task management.
Contracts and Confidentiality
Having clear contracts and confidentiality agreements in place protects the company's IP and interests.
Milestones and Revisions
Defining milestones and a revision process helps in managing expectations and delivering quality work.
Challenges to Watch Out For
Scope Creep
Scope creep can be managed by having clear project specifications and change management processes.
Communication Barriers
Communication barriers can be overcome by using collaboration tools and scheduling regular check-ins.
Time Zone Differences
For remote teams, time zone differences can be managed by adjusting work hours or using asynchronous communication methods.
Cultural Differences
Cultural differences can be addressed by promoting a culture of inclusivity and respect.
Actionable Next Steps
To start hiring a verification engineer in Chennai, India, follow these steps:
- Sign Up on our platform
- Enter Your Search Criteria for verification engineers
- Browse Candidates and their profiles
- Screen Candidates based on your requirements
- Reach Out to Shortlisted Candidates
- Start hiring top verification engineers in Chennai today
FAQ
What skills are essential for a verification engineer?
Essential skills include proficiency in HDLs, understanding of verification methodologies like UVM, familiarity with simulation tools, and programming skills.
How do I find verification engineers in Chennai?
You can find verification engineers through professional networks, job boards, and recruitment agencies specializing in tech talent.
What is the average salary range for verification engineers in Chennai?
The salary range varies based on experience, skills, and company. On average, it can range from ₹8 lakhs to ₹20 lakhs per annum.
How do I ensure the quality of work from a remote verification engineer?
Ensure quality by setting clear expectations, using collaboration tools, and conducting regular check-ins.
Conclusion
Hiring a verification engineer in Chennai, India, can be a strategic move for companies looking to leverage top talent in the semiconductor and electronics industry. By understanding the key skills required, following a structured screening and interviewing process, and ensuring successful collaboration, companies can find the right professionals to drive their projects forward.







